Main Responsibilities:
• Develop and optimize Credit Control processes across the organization
• Manage dealer and customer collaterals, receivables, and collection processes, monitor aging and overdue accounts
• Analyse financial strength and risk levels of dealers and new projects; conduct credit assessments
• Improve cash collection performance in coordination with Sales and Accounting
• Ensure dealer compliance with contracts and financial operations
• Support regional and local Credit Committees and contribute to financial decisions
• Negotiate truck sales campaigns with banks and develop financing solutions
• Ensure compliance with internal control standards and regulations; implement new procedures when needed
• Coordinate internal and external audits and follow up findings
• Develop and maintain business continuity and risk mitigation plans
• Prepare internal control, risk, and audit-related reports and ensure continuous process improvement
• Prepare internal control, risk and financial (working capital, DSO, cash flow, etc.)
• Follow up legal cases with external legal offices and inform stakeholders
• Manage contracts, procedures and corporate documentation
• Ensure alignment with Head Office policies and maintain regular communication
• Managing treasury operations and cash flow planning to ensure liquidity, financial stability and efficient fund management
